"slow Losers" And Long Term Results?
I never thought the sleeve would not work, I am just over five months out, and have lost, including pre-sleeve loss 89 lbs. I weigh in again today - more loss? Maybe. I have metabolic issues that make stalls more prominent, plus it is very important to me to lose no muscle mass. I was in my low 240's when I was sleeved, and I am now at 190. I no longer am diabetic, and I have went from 40 BMI to 27. My weight loss is already successful. The rest will be great, i will take what I can, but it has already worked. I have gave myself years back. My husband has me back. I was always a fighter, this lets us fight - I don't mind the effort, or being one of the people to lose it slowly. I feel every loss, see every inch and know I fought for that.

Cost Of Pre & Post Surgery Products
Okay - I talked to a few people, including a lady with the Texas Medical Board, this seems to be the best route for anyone (everyone) this is happening with: Start an email thread about your appointments, etc. what is left - establish that your doctor has plans to operate on you, provided your tests and requirements, etc. are met. Gather your information - email you doctor and tell them you wish to opt out of their product choice. Be specific and tell them you have 1) observed many people discussing that they cannot stomach one brand of supplement very long, 2) you dislike the products in question and 3) you want and need to pay as you go for supplements 4) want your consumer rights to be respected. Then ask them, point blank, why they feel it is necessary for you to purchase that product from them, what difference there is in that product that makes it so, and (this is a biggie) do they make a profit from MAKING you buy that product. Request politely that they respond to each question, and explain, politely, that this has raised concerns with you. Maintain your composure, and then confirm your next appointment. THEN: If they do not step down, file a complaint with the medical board they are practicing in - and follow up. Hope that helps!

Why
There are many reasons for stalls, but the hold-slip-hold-slip for most of us is not just fat loss. Yo udo not just lose fat. It doesnt drop off the minute you jump on the treadmill...it isn't gas. It is fuel, but fuel locked in a complex little warehouse...it has to be accessed, opened, broken down and then utilized and ina more aggressive mode, like the retention we call "starvation mode". It will hold onto as much from that fat cell as it can, reuse everything it can. Every pound of fat has 7 miles of capilaries. All this stuff has to break down, be used and flushed away. In starvation mode your body is compensating by holding onto what was left in a (kind of) edematous fashion. It holds (some cases better than others - also depends on triggers it recieves) onto the leftovers and Water, and then will releaswe them - thus the actual show of weight loss, even though you could already see it in inches. There is always the situation that if you know you have a cardiovascular co morbidity or diabeties, have had serious Fluid retention thta the stalls might mean something else - but that is why you should be seeing a PCP regularly during you weight loss. I am not a doctor, and I pulled this from memoery and not from a website or anything, so don't just take my word on it - and I pushed a very complex concept into a small space...just some FYI.

Mental Issues
The food reference was suprising to me - be very careful though. It does seem a bit much. One thing not often mentioned is that you do not always feel the pain from pushing your sleeve till later - maybe even the next day. I was slow to feel the full mark on mushies, and the next day I would feel bad, sometimes really bad. Once I started actually measuring my food to what I knew to be less than my "full" mark, but enough to feel satiated, I began to hurt alot less. PS - I do nto think it is possible to stretch your sleleve quickly, but with my understanding of internat sutures, I bet it is possible to make it heal at a larger size than it would have by constantly stretching it out with food as it "positions" and heals.
